A set of low-speed wind-tunnel tests was performed at the …Hybrid propulsion is a mix of both solid and liquid/gas forms of propulsion. In a hybrid rocket, the fuel is typically a solid grain, and the oxidizer (often gaseous oxygen) is stored separately. The rocket is then ignited by injecting the oxidizer into the solid motor and igniting it with a spark or torch system.

Civil aircraft propulsion faces important opportunities and challenges. Opportunities include the improvement of overall propulsion efficiency from 40 percent to 60 percent, elimination of aircraft noise, and realization of urban air mobility vehicles. Each application is rich in technical opportunities.

Supersonic Propulsion …The Aero-Acoustic Propulsion Laboratory (AAPL) is a world-class facility providing outstanding testing services in aircraft noise reduction, with an emphasis in engine nozzle and fan components. Unique in testing capabilities and size, the AAPL dome is 65-ft high by 130-ft in diameter and covered with acoustic treatment internally to provide an ...It serves as a flexible, relevant, experimental aeroacoustic and aero-performance test bed, providing valuable information throughout NASA’s technology maturation process for a variety of multidisciplinary research that includes turbofan noise, engine controls, installation effects, and measurement technologies.Several milestones were reached during 2020 in the testing and assembly of X-57 flight hardware.
